Why this matters

What's actually happening today

Cold outbound at zero customers is brutal

No social proof, no logos, no familiar brand. Cold outbound can burn through your market before you learn much.

Launch directories give you spikes, not always learning

Product Hunt, BetaList, etc. can surface curious visitors who churn within 24 hours. Stronger learning often comes from real people describing the problem in their own words.

Founder-led learning can work before you have scale

Many early startups learn from a few focused communities before they scale. The bottleneck is finding threads that are relevant enough to deserve real attention.
